The Gaussmeter G80 is suitable for measuring the surface magnetic field of permanent magnet materials, DC motors, speakers, magnetic separators, and the working magnetic field of permanent magnet iron separators, as well as the measurement of workpiece residual magnetism. It is widely used by manufacturers of magnetic materials, permanent magnet motors, permanent magnet iron separators, as well as application units, the power industry, and the railway industry.

G80 Gauss meter features a DC sensitivity of 2%, resolution of 0.1G (0.01mT), and range of 20kG (2T).
Frequency response range: DC-100Hz, compatible with radial or axial probes.
Additionally, the Gaussmeter G80 features DC/AC magnetic field measurement, N/S magnetic polarity indication, and maximum/minimum value measurement functions.
The Gaussmeter G80 utilizes Fourier analysis to measure AC magnetic fields (RMS values).
Ideal for measuring the magnetic fields of various waveforms (sine wave, square wave, triangular wave, trapezoidal wave, sawtooth wave, etc.) in AC.
